Pentagon: Russia Put Weapon into Space on May 16

Russia last week launched a satellite that U.S. intelligence officials believe to be a weapon capable of inspecting and attacking other satellites, the U.S. Space Command said on Tuesday as the Russian spacecraft trails a U.S. spy satellite in orbit.Russia’s Soyuz rocket…[#item_full_content]
